掌握CSS层叠样式表原理,打造高效网页布局!

作者:来宾麻将开发公司 阅读:14 次 发布时间:2025-07-09 01:19:43

摘要:CSS层叠样式表是一种用于控制网页布局和样式的语言。它的出现给网页设计师和开发者带来了很大的便利,因为它可以让他们更轻松地管理和控制网页的样式。然而,要真正掌握CSS层叠样式表原理,并打造高效网页布局,还需要更深入的了解和实践。在本文中,我们将探讨CSS层叠样式表...

CSS层叠样式表是一种用于控制网页布局和样式的语言。它的出现给网页设计师和开发者带来了很大的便利,因为它可以让他们更轻松地管理和控制网页的样式。然而,要真正掌握CSS层叠样式表原理,并打造高效网页布局,还需要更深入的了解和实践。在本文中,我们将探讨CSS层叠样式表的一些重要概念和使用技巧。

掌握CSS层叠样式表原理,打造高效网页布局!

1. CSS层叠样式表是什么?

CSS层叠样式表(Cascading Style Sheets)是一种用于网页样式控制的语言,它可以控制网页的布局、颜色、字体、大小等。CSS由一系列的规则构成,这些规则包括选择器、属性和值。CSS样式可以应用到HTML和XML等文档类型上。

2. CSS层叠样式表的重要性

CSS层叠样式表极大地提高了网页设计和开发的效率,它让网页开发者可以更好地控制网页的样式和布局。这样使得网页开发更加灵活且易于维护。 CSS层叠样式表也大大改进了网页的可访问性、搜索引擎优化和网站的性能。

3. CSS选择器

CSS选择器是一种用于识别和选择不同元素的语法。在CSS中,选择器可以指定特定的HTML元素,类别名或标签等等。在CSS中,有各种类型的选择器,例如:ID选择器、类选择器、后代选择器、属性选择器、伪类和伪元素选择器等等。选择器的使用可以让CSS更加规范化,更易于阅读和维护。

4. CSS优先级和层叠顺序

CSS样式可以重叠,并且当多个样式应用于同一个HTML元素时,需要考虑它们的优先级。CSS层叠样式表具有不同的层叠顺序和优先级,这些决定了样式的应用顺序。

在CSS中,选择器的优先级是基于其特征的不同组成部分来计算的。对于同一个元素,具有更高优先级的样式将覆盖较低优先级的样式。

5. CSS布局

CSS布局用于定义元素在网页中的位置和大小。 CSS盒模型定义了网页中每个元素的位置、尺寸和边距。 CSS布局服务于网页设计的关键目标,在页面中引导用户,并帮助用户了解页面的内容层次结构。

6. CSS动画和过渡

CSS动画和过渡是运用于网页中、对网页特定元素进行一定程度的动画处理和变化的技术。过渡效果提供了在一段时间内渐变过渡元素样式的机会,而CSS动画提供了在特定时间间隔内运动元素的机会。

7. CSS视觉效果技巧

CSS视觉效果技巧利用CSS样式和属性为页面元素添加特殊的视觉效果。CSS阴影、边框、渐变和旋转等技巧可以使页面的元素更加美观有吸引力,同时也有助于用户理解和快速浏览页面的内容。

8. 弹性布局

弹性布局是一种设计网页布局的技术,它基于CSS3中新增的弹性盒布局,可以改变网页中元素的位置大小以适应不同的屏幕和设备尺寸,使页面更加灵活自适应。弹性布局是现代网页设计中的重要部分,因为它可以解决设计师面对的屏幕和设备尺寸不断增多的问题。

9. 响应式设计

响应式设计是一种网页开发技术,可以根据不同的屏幕尺寸和设备类型自适应调整网页的布局和样式。响应式设计可以适应任何设备类型,不仅让人们的使用体验更好,也可以帮助网站在搜索引擎中得到更好的排名。在现代网页设计中,响应式设计已成为一个不可或缺的部分。

结论

通过对CSS层叠样式表的一些重要概念和使用技巧进行探讨,我们可以更好地了解如何使用CSS设计和开发高效的网页布局和样式。 CSS是一个十分重要的语言,对网页设计和开发都有着重要作用。熟练掌握CSS的重要概念和技巧,可以让你成为一个优秀的网页设计师和开发者。

  • 原标题:掌握CSS层叠样式表原理,打造高效网页布局!

  • 本文链接:https://qipaikaifa.cn/zxzx/21055.html

  • 本文由深圳中天华智网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与中天华智网联系删除。
  • 微信二维码

    ZTHZ2028

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:157-1842-0347


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部